I found the solution:

In the SAP Customizing Implementation Guide (IMG) of the SAP ECC system, you have made the Customizing settings for Recruitment under Integration with Other Components --> Business Packages / Functional Packages --> Manager Self-Service (mySAP ERP).

Here is a task E-Recruiting --> RFC or Systemname

here you have to make your own RFC-Destination.
